The cancelling relayer is being paid in receivingAssetId on the sendingChain instead of in sendingAssetID. If the user relies on a relayer to cancel transactions, and that receivingAssetId asset does not exist on the sending chain (assuming only sendingAssetID on the sending chain and receivingAssetId on the receiving chain are assured to be valid and present), then the cancel transaction from the relayer will always revert and users funds will remain locked on the sending chain.
The impact is that expired transfers can never be cancelled and user funds will be locked forever if user relies on a relayer.
Recommend changing receivingAssetId to sendingAssetId in transferAsset() on TransactionManager.sol L514.
